ADDITIONAL STEPS FOR INTERNATIONAL APPLICANTS
Transcript Evaluation:
A course-by-course evaluation from a NACES-approved organization is required. The university covers the cost after receiving your application and official English language proficiency score. Submit unofficial transcripts, diploma, and (if applicable) post-baccalaureate documents.
Bachelor’s Degree Policy:
3-year degrees are not accepted unless followed by a 1–2 year post-baccalaureate program.
Official Transcripts & Translations:
Required upon admission. Must be officially translated if not in English.
English Proficiency:
Submit valid scores from one of the following exams:
TOEFL iBT: 90 | IELTS Academic: 7.0 | Duolingo: 115
I-20 & Visa Documentation:
APPLICATION DEADLINES
SPRING 2026 ENTRY:
Priority Deadline August 31, 2025
International Deadline October 1, 2025
FALL 2026 ENTRY:
Priority Deadline February 3, 2026
International Deadline April 1, 2026
• I-20 Submission: Admitted students must submit I-20 documentation by the specified deadline. The I-20’s required funding amount exceeds the program’s tuition and fees. An F-1 visa is mandatory to begin the program.
• Current Visa Holders: If you hold a visa other than F-1, consult an immigration attorney to confirm your eligibility to enroll. Optional Practical Training (OPT) is available only on an F-1 visa. If you need to switch to F-1 status, complete the visa process before starting the program.
